I doubt we'll see a main FF on Wii... DEFINENTLY not FFXIII, at the very least.

 

It would be nice though.  Sadly, it seems Nintendo has been relegated to the spinoff/sequel/remake end of the FF universe, while consoles with the beef (PS3, and potentially 360) will get the real goods.  FF games, ever since the PSX days at least, have been all about making visual marvels with technical flair.  The Wii just simply isn't capable of near the visceral quality the other systems are... right now its struggling to keep up with last gen.  I think developers are reacting to Wii with "this isn't a console we can release our core titles on", which is kindof a shame.

 

Plus, everyone expects Wii games to use motion-sensing, something very out-of-place in the RPG world.  What RPG makers SHOULD do for Wii is use the "Wii Pointer Technology" (known as IR Triangulation outside N's marketing division) to make menu-driven RPGs into a point-and-click interface.  Done right, I think it could really streamline menu-driven battles.  Imagine a game like FFXII where you point-and-click enemies for attacks, and other buttons call up quick menus to fire off spells and items.  It'd be killer.
